What’s the Deal with HCC Coding?

First things first—let’s get to the heart of the matter. HCC stands for Hierarchical Condition Categories, and it’s essentially a coding system designed to evaluate the risk and health status of patients. The key here is that HCC coding allows healthcare providers to document the complexity of a patient’s conditions and take into account the resources required for their care.

Isn't that a breath of fresh air? Instead of a cookie-cutter approach to healthcare reimbursement, this model promotes a more tailored and equitable system, ensuring that healthcare providers get compensated fairly based on the actual care they provide.

Why Accuracy Matters

Now, you might wonder, "What’s the benefit of submitting accurate HCC codes?" Well, let’s clear that up because this isn't just a dry coding exercise—it's a crucial part of the healthcare financial ecosystem. The correct answer to that question? It’s about receiving appropriate reimbursement that mirrors patient care requirements.

When HCC codes accurately reflect a patient's diagnoses, it’s like providing a roadmap for reimbursement. Healthcare providers can receive payments that are aligned with the resources and complexities they’ve encountered while caring for patients. If the code doesn’t match the reality of the patient’s condition, it could upset the balance, leaving the provider feeling the pinch. Can you imagine putting in all that extra work, only to be handed a bill that shortchanges your efforts?

But let’s not stop there. This accuracy helps ensure that healthcare systems can maintain quality care by being sufficiently compensated for treating patients with diverse and often complex health conditions.
